WRX and a BMW wagon

The owner of the WRX requested a non paint correctional exterior detail along with some random interior requests.

Total time: 4 hours

wash
clay
Poli seal udm orange pad 6
collonite 845 udm white pad 3 (thanks Howareb)
Armorall extreme shine x2 on tires
poli seal on exhaust tip
DG quick detailer on windows

2001 540 wagon - rock hard paint and most swirls were deep.

This car also belongs to the owner of Martin Motorsport.

Not 100% swirl free, but greatly improved. (Like with all his cars this one will be messed up after the first wash)

Total time: 7.5 hours

wash
clay
EC purple wool 1800rpm
SIP green ccs pad 1800 rpm
poli seal udm 6
Extreme top coat udm 5
